What does a senior financial manager do?

A senior financial manager oversees an organization’s financial planning, analysis, and reporting. They develop budgets, monitor financial performance, ensure compliance with regulations, and provide strategic advice to support business growth. Strong analytical skills and proficiency with financial software are essential for this role.

What are some typical challenges a Sr Financial Manager faces when leading cross-departmental budgeting processes?

Sr Financial Managers often encounter challenges when aligning the financial objectives of diverse departments, as each may have different priorities and spending needs. Balancing these interests while maintaining organizational financial health requires strong negotiation, communication, and analytical skills. Additionally, managing tight deadlines and ensuring accurate, timely data from multiple stakeholders are common hurdles. Successfully navigating these requires proactive planning and fostering collaborative relationships with department heads.

What is the difference between Sr Financial Manager vs Financial Analyst?

AspectSr Financial ManagerFinancial Analyst
CredentialsBach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or related; often MBA or CPABachelor's degree in Finance, Economics, or related; sometimes certifications like CFA
Work EnvironmentSenior management teams, strategic planning, budgetingData analysis, financial modeling, reporting
Employer & Industry UsageCorporate finance departments, large organizationsFinancial services, investment firms, corporate finance

The main difference is that Sr Financial Managers focus on strategic financial planning and leadership, while Financial Analysts primarily analyze data and prepare reports. Sr Financial Managers oversee teams and make high-level decisions, whereas Financial Analysts support these decisions with detailed analysis.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sr Financial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sr Financial Manager, you need advanced expertise in financial anal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and a bachelor's or master's degree in finance, accounting, or a related field—often accompanied by a CPA, CFA, or similar certification. Proficiency in financial management software, ERP systems like SAP or Oracle, and advanced Excel skills is typically required. Strong leadership, strategic thinking, and effective communication are vital soft skills for guiding teams and collaborating with stakeholders. These skills enable effective financial planning, risk management, and informed decision-making, driving organizational success.

Job description

Description

Position Summary

Seeking a Sr. Financial Manager to join Credit One's Products Team. This is a hybrid financial analysis / data science position.

The Products team is responsible for profitably expanding our product line with innovative credit card offerings, while also managing our existing products to meet financial hurdles. In this role, you will play a key role in evaluating the financial viability of our newest credit card products, partnerships, and business opportunities.

Summary of Essential Job Functions
  • Build and own detailed financial P&L models that evaluate the financial viability of new products and new business opportunities
  • Present model output to peers, department leaders, and management
  • Review and assess analytical reports prepared by others and make recommendations
  • Utilize database tools to manage, manipulate and analyze large sets of financial information
  • Perform ad-hoc analysis, primarily related to anomaly detection and investigation
  • Review monthly performance trends and KPIs to identify and recommend product enhancements
  • Collaborate with key stakeholders from across the bank
Position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Economics, Computer Science, Mathematics, Statistics or related field
  • 6+ years relevant work experience in a similar role in a professional corporate environment
  • Ability to use of at least one of the following: Snowflake, SQL Server, Oracle, or SAS
  • Advanced excel skills and the ability to build, understand, and follow complex financial models and P&Ls
  • Strong verbal, written and interpersonal skills
  • Willing to take ownership of your work product
  • Ability to partner with management to drive solutions
  • Ability to work collaboratively as part of a small team
  • Detail oriented and analytically savvy
  • Proficient presenting your work in PowerPoint
Preferred
  • Experience in FP&A or corporate finance
